HP DL380 G7 - HDD and RAID Problem
I have problem with server, 2 HDD was failed same time, where 3 HDD was configured Raid 5. I replaced 2 HDD and got following message through array controller, "Drive array resuming automatic data recovery".
I can't go in side windows. Windows was installed in raid drive.
I have very important data on the server. In raid utility showing raid 5 logical drive status- recovering.
Please advice what to do?

Re: HP DL380 G7 - HDD and RAID Problem
RAID 5 can only recover from a single drive failure, if you had two defective drives the data is not recoverable.
